President of South Sudan in Angola for two-day visit

Salva Kiir Mayardit, President of South Sudan, is in Angola for a 48-hour working visit, at the invitation of the President of the Republic, João Lourenço.

According to the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Salva Kiir Mayardit began his visit this Monday. "Salva Kiir Mayardit, President of the Republic of South Sudan, began this Monday a 48-hour working visit to Angola, at the invitation of João Manuel Gonçalves Lourenço, President of the Republic of Angola", reads a brief note from the ministry, to which VerAngola had access.

Téte António, Minister of Foreign Affairs, as well as other figures, welcomed the President of South Sudan, upon his arrival at 4 de Fevereiro International Airport.

Salva Kiir Mayardit's visit to the country takes place within the scope of the common interest of sharing information regarding the peace process in the east of the Democratic Republic of Congo, in line with the processes in Luanda and Nairobi, according to a statement, cited by Angop.

Therefore, the President of South Sudan, as acting president of the East African Community, will analyze matters relating to the situation in that country with local authorities.

It should be remembered that both Angola and South Sudan are part of the International on the Great Lakes Region (CIRGL), founded in 1994, aiming to resolve peace and security matters in the region.
